uC/GUI图形界面软件深入解析
版权申诉
170 浏览量
更新于2024-10-09
收藏 1.65MB RAR 举报
资源摘要信息:"uC/GUI是由Micrium公司开发的一款通用嵌入式用户图形界面软件,用于为各种图形LCD应用程序提供处理器和LCD控制器无关的图形用户接口。该软件包中包含了一个名为'my_ucgui.rar'的压缩文件,版本为v3.98。文件列表中还包括一个文本文件'***.txt'。"
以下是详细的知识点说明:
1. Micrium公司简介:
Micrium是一家专注于嵌入式系统软件的公司,以其高性能、可靠性、可预测性及模块化设计著称。Micrium的产品被广泛应用于航天、医疗、消费电子等多个行业领域,提供全面的软件解决方案,包括实时操作系统(RTOS)、文件系统、通信协议栈、图形用户界面(GUI)等。
2. uC/GUI概述:
uC/GUI是Micrium推出的一款图形用户界面软件,旨在为嵌入式系统提供一个简单、直观、高效的用户交互界面。它具有以下特点:
- 独立性:与处理器和LCD控制器无关,这意味着开发者可以在不同的硬件平台上部署相同的GUI代码。
- 可配置性:开发人员可以根据具体需求配置GUI的模块和功能,以优化性能和资源使用。
- 高效性:uC/GUI优化了图形渲染和事件处理,以减少对CPU和内存资源的需求。
3. uC/GUI版本v3.98:
本次提供的资源是uC/GUI的3.98版本,这是一个成熟稳定的版本,可能包含了一系列的功能增强和bug修复,相对于早期版本,新版本通常会有更好的性能和用户体验。开发者可以依赖此版本构建稳定的图形界面。
4. 图形处理器(GPU):
在讨论图形用户界面时,图形处理器是一个重要的硬件组件。虽然uC/GUI强调了其与LCD控制器的无关性,但在某些情况下,尤其是高分辨率图形渲染和动画效果时,图形处理器可以大幅提高性能。GPU擅长于进行大量的并行计算,这对于图形渲染尤其重要。
5. 文件名称分析:
- my_ucgui.rar:这是一个压缩文件,包含了uC/GUI相关文件和资源,可能包括源代码、库文件、示例程序、文档等。
***.txt:这是一个文本文件,可能是一个说明文档、更新日志、或者是对'***'网站上的内容介绍。***是中国一个著名的软件资源下载网站,可能该文件是与uC/GUI在该网站上的具体详情有关的链接或说明。
6. 开发与应用:
uC/GUI的使用场景非常广泛,如家用电器、医疗设备、工业控制面板、汽车信息娱乐系统等。开发者可以利用uC/GUI创建各种图形元素,如按钮、滑动条、图表、文本显示等,为用户提供直观的交互方式。
7. 社区与支持:
Micrium公司为其产品提供专业的技术支持,同时,用户社区也是学习和解决问题的重要渠道。开发者在使用uC/GUI时,可以访问相关的论坛和文档,与其他开发者交流经验,解决开发过程中遇到的问题。
8. 其他资源:
- Micrium还提供了其它组件,如MicroC/OS-II和MicroC/OS-III,这些是公司的知名实时操作系统。与uC/GUI结合使用,可以为开发者提供完整的嵌入式系统解决方案。
- 对于文件列表中的'***.txt',开发者需要检查文件内容来确定其具体用途,可能是提供相关的下载链接、参考资源或文档。
总之,uC/GUI是一个功能强大的嵌入式GUI软件,开发者可以利用它来构建高效且用户友好的图形界面。v3.98版本作为稳定版,对于希望快速开发的项目来说是一个很好的选择。
2022-09-24 上传
2020-03-17 上传
2022-09-20 上传
2023-07-04 上传
2023-07-31 上传
2023-10-05 上传
2023-07-10 上传
2023-05-19 上传
2023-05-18 上传
御道御小黑
- 粉丝: 68
- 资源: 1万+
最新资源
- Postman安装与功能详解:适用于API测试与HTTP请求
- Dart打造简易Web服务器教程:simple-server-dart
- FFmpeg 4.4 快速搭建与环境变量配置教程
- 牛顿井在围棋中的应用:利用牛顿多项式求根技术
- SpringBoot结合MySQL实现MQTT消息持久化教程
- C语言实现水仙花数输出方法详解
- Avatar_Utils库1.0.10版本发布,Python开发者必备工具
- Python爬虫实现漫画榜单数据处理与可视化分析
- 解压缩教材程序文件的正确方法
- 快速搭建Spring Boot Web项目实战指南
- Avatar Utils 1.8.1 工具包的安装与使用指南
- GatewayWorker扩展包压缩文件的下载与使用指南
- 实现饮食目标的开源Visual Basic编码程序
- 打造个性化O'RLY动物封面生成器
- Avatar_Utils库打包文件安装与使用指南
- Python端口扫描工具的设计与实现要点解析